>Le Mercredi 9 Février 2005 21:05, Taco Witte a écrit :
>> Hi Linphone developers,
>>
>> After almost giving up I found out (inspired by [1]) that the
>> "Cisco-SIPGateway/IOS-12.x" server used by Nikotel.com sends "MD5"
>> instead of MD5 during the authentication procedure. I'd suggest the
>> attached patch (against 1.0.0pre8) to make it work.

Hello,

I have the same problem with my provider, who uses Sip EXpress Router.
( http://www.iptel.org/ser/ )

SER also sends "MD5" instead of MD5, and i have inspired by the same
website to look at the packages it sends to Linphone.

If I'm correct there is no fix in the Linphone CVS yet, to allow it
overcome this small problem.

I have patched my Linphone so I can use it now, but could you please
tell me anything about making it official? Or maybe you refuse to
implement the "fix" due to its standard non-compliance? That wouldn't
be a good situation from the end user point of view, because other
clients allow broken servers to send quotes, so there is "no big
problem" for the VOIP providers, so they won't fix it/deploy fixed
servers. (Which needs the server software to be fixed in the first
place, which just adds to the long wait of the end user.)


So would really appreciate if you would implement this 2 line long "fix",
